远程VPS选购指南从入门到精通的全面解析
卡尔云官网
www.kaeryun.com
什么是远程VPS?
远程VPS(Virtual Private Server,虚拟专用服务器)就像是你租用的"网上电脑"。想象一下,你在家里用笔记本,而VPS就是一台24小时不关机、放在数据中心的电脑,你可以随时通过网络远程连接使用它。它不同于传统的物理服务器,而是通过虚拟化技术将一台强大的物理服务器分割成多个独立的虚拟服务器。
举个通俗的例子:就像一栋大楼被分割成多个独立公寓,每个公寓有自己的门锁、水电表,互不干扰。VPS就是这样"虚拟公寓",你租用其中一个"房间",拥有完全的控制权。
为什么你需要远程VPS?
1. 网站托管需求
如果你要建网站(比如个人博客、电商平台),VPS比共享主机更稳定可靠。我有个客户用了共享主机,结果因为同服务器其他用户流量暴增导致他的网站频繁宕机。迁移到VPS后,问题立刻解决。
2. 开发测试环境
程序员可以在VPS上搭建测试环境,不用担心弄坏本地电脑配置。我曾用5美元的月付VPS搭建了完整的LAMP环境测试新项目。
3. 数据备份与存储
重要文件可以加密后存储在VPS上作为异地备份。2020年我亲历硬盘损坏事故后,现在所有重要资料都会同步到VPS一份。
4. 科学上网与隐私保护
通过VPS自建代理比用公共VPN更安全(当然要遵守当地法律法规)。技术上这是通过SS/SSR/V2Ray等协议实现的。
VPS核心参数详解
CPU性能
不要只看核心数!我曾经被某商家"8核CPU"宣传吸引,结果实际性能还不如优质商家的2核。关键看:
- CPU型号(E5 v4 > E5 v3)
- 是否独占核心(部分商家会超售)
- 主频高低(2.4GHz > 1.8GHz)
内存大小
内存决定能同时运行多少程序:
- 1GB:适合基础网站
- 2GB:可运行MySQL+PHP中等负载
- 4GB+:可部署多个docker容器
注意:某些商家标称的"突发内存"只是临时可用值。
硬盘类型与IO
机械硬盘(HDD)和固态硬盘(SSD)速度差距巨大:
- HDD:顺序读写约100MB/s
- SSD:可达500MB/s以上
建议优先选择SSD机型,特别是数据库应用。
带宽与流量
常见陷阱:
1. "无限流量"但限制带宽为10Mbps
2. "100Mbps带宽"但每月限1TB流量
3. "CN2线路"但实际是普通线路混用
建议根据业务需求选择:
- 小流量业务:1TB/月足够
- 视频类业务:需5TB+和50Mbps+带宽
VPS网络质量关键指标
Ping值(延迟)
从你电脑到VSP的响应时间:
- <50ms:极佳(同城机房)
- 50-100ms:良好(国内跨省)
- >150ms:明显卡顿(国际线路)
测试方法:
```
ping your.vps.ip
MTR路由追踪
可以显示网络路径上的每一跳延迟:
mtr -r -c 10 your.vps.ip
我曾通过这个命令发现某商家的"香港机房"实际路由先绕道美国。
TCP/UDP丢包率
影响实际传输稳定性:
Linux下测试
iperf3 -c your.vps.ip
良好网络丢包率应<1%。
VPS操作系统选择指南
Linux发行版对比
| 系统 | 特点 | 适用场景 |
|------|------|----------|
| CentOS | 稳定可靠 | 企业级应用 |
| Ubuntu | 易用性强 | Web开发 |
| Debian | 资源占用低 | ARM架构设备 |
| Alpine | 极致轻量 | Docker容器 |
个人建议新手从Ubuntu开始,遇到问题网上解决方案最多。
Windows Server注意事项
1. 需要额外授权费用(通常$10+/月)
2. 内存要求高(至少2GB才能流畅运行)
3. RDP远程桌面需要做好安全防护:
- 修改默认3389端口
- 启用网络级认证(NLA)
-设置账户锁定策略防爆破
VPS安全防护必做清单
SSH基础加固(Linux)
1. 禁用root登录:
```
PermitRootLogin no
2. 改用密钥认证:
```bash
ssh-keygen -t rsa -b4096
ssh-copy-id user@vps_ip
3. 修改默认端口:
Port你的自定义端口号>1024
去年我审计的30台VPS中,有17台因为使用默认22端口遭到过扫描攻击。
Firewall防火墙配置
UFW简易设置示例:
```bash
sudo ufw allow你的SSH端口/tcp
sudo ufw allow80/tcp
HTTP
sudo ufw allow443/tcp
HTTPS
sudo ufw enable
进阶建议安装fail2ban防暴力破解:
sudo apt install fail2ban
sudo systemctl enable fail2ban
VPS性能优化技巧
SWAP空间设置(针对小内存机型)
创建4GB交换文件
sudo fallocate -l4G /swapfile
sudo chmod600 /swapfile
sudo mkswap /swapfile
sudo swapon /swapfile
添加到fstab永久生效
echo'/swapfile none swap sw00'| sudo tee-a /etc/fstab
调整swappiness值(推荐10-30)
echo'vm.swappiness=10'| sudo tee-a /etc/sysctl.conf
sudo sysctl-p
我的一个512MB内存的VPS通过这样设置成功运行了WordPress小型站点。
Nginx/Apache优化参数
Nginx示例优化:
worker_processes auto;
自动匹配CPU核心数
events{
worker_connections1024;
每个worker的连接数
multi_accepton;
同时接受新连接
}
http{
sendfileon;
启用高效文件传输模式
tcp_nopushon;
优化数据包发送
keepalive_timeout65;
保持连接时间
Apache对应优化项在mpm_prefork模块中调整。
VPS备份策略设计原则
"3-2-1备份法则"
我从2018年开始实践这个原则后从未丢失过数据:
1. 3份拷贝:原始数据+两份备份
2. 2种介质:比如SSD+机械硬盘
3. 1份异地:至少一份在其他机房
具体实现方案示例:
每日自动压缩网站目录并SCP传输到备份服务器
tar-czvf /backups/site_$(date +%F).tar.gz/var/www/html
scp/backups/site_*.tar.gz backup_user@backup_server:/remote_backup/
保留最近7天备份
find /backups/-name "site_*.tar.gz"-mtime +7-delete
VPS常见问题排查手册
当你发现网站打不开时:
1️⃣ 第一步检查网络连通性
ping your.vps.ip
traceroute your.vps.ip
2️⃣ 第二步检查服务是否运行
systemctl status nginx/mysql/你的服务名
netstat-tulnp | grep:80
查看80端口监听情况
journalctl-xe--no-pager | tail-n50
查看最新系统日志
3️⃣ 第三步检查资源占用
top
实时进程监控
df-h
磁盘空间检查
free-h
内存使用情况
iftop-n
网络流量监控(需安装)
VPS选购避坑指南——商家套路解析
根据我5年使用20+家供应商的经验:
❌ 警惕这些宣传话术:
-"企业级SSD"(实际可能是二手盘)
-"99.9%在线率"(SLA条款可能有除外条款)
-"无限流量"(隐藏限速条款)
✅ 推荐验证方法:
1.Bench.sh综合测试脚本:
wget-qO-bench.sh | bash
2.YABS性能测试:
curl-sL yabs.sh | bash
3.Ping.pe全球节点延迟测试
🛡️ 特别提醒中国用户:
如果业务主要面向国内用户,务必确认:
1.VIP是否有ICP备案资质
2.BGP线路是否包含电信/联通/移动
3.CN2 GIA还是普通CN2(延迟差30ms+)
我曾帮客户从某国际知名商家迁移回国就是因为跨国延迟导致用户体验太差。
VPS管理工具推荐清单
🔧 SSH客户端:
-Win: Xshell(免费版)/Termius
-Mac: Royal TSX/iTerm2
-Linux:原生终端+tmux
🌐 Web管理面板:
-BT宝塔面板(中文友好)
-cPanel(国际标准但收费贵)
-VestaCP(轻量免费)
📊 监控工具:
-Prometheus+Grafana(专业级)
-Netdata(实时可视化)
-Uptime Kuma(简易状态页)
🔄 自动化部署:
-Ansible playbook
-Docker compose
-Terraform脚本
我的日常工作流是: VS Code写Ansible剧本 -> Git提交 -> Jenkins自动部署到多台VSP。
VSP进阶玩法案例
🚀 案例一:搭建私有云盘Nextcloud
需求:替代百度网盘的自建方案
配置要求:
-CPU:双核
-RAM:≥4GB
-Storage:≥100GB SSD
带宽:≥50Mbps
📈 案例二:加密货币节点
跑比特币全节点需要:
-500GB+存储空间
-Port8333开放
建议使用ARM架构机型更省电
🎮 案例三:游戏私服
Minecraft服务器配置参考:
玩家数<10:2核4GB
玩家数20+:4核8GB+
必须选择低延迟(<50ms)机房
我曾经用$5/月的OVZ架构VSP跑MC服带10个朋友玩,后来升级到KVM才解决卡顿问题。
VSP未来技术趋势观察
🔮预测未来三年发展:
1.边缘计算融合:CDN厂商会推出分布式微型VP5,如Cloudflare Workers这种serverless方案
2.ARM架构崛起:AWS Graviton芯片已证明ARM在服务器领域的性价比优势,预计会有更多低价ARM VP5选项
3.NVMe普及:PCIe4.0固态硬盘将成为中高端标配,IO性能比当前SATA SSD提升300%+
4.IPv6-only经济型方案:随着IPv4地址枯竭,纯IPv6 VP5价格可能降至$1/月以下
作为从业者,我建议现在学习容器化技术和Terraform基础设施即代码(IaC),这些技能会越来越重要。
---
希望这篇5000字的长文能帮你全面了解VP5的方方面面。如果有具体的使用场景问题,欢迎在评论区留言交流!记得点赞收藏哦~
TAG:远程 vps,远程 VAN,远程vps出租,远程vps管理工具,远程vps控制软件,远程vps是什么卡尔云官网
www.kaeryun.com